Small for Gestational Age (SGA) or Small For Date (SFD): birth weight lower than expected for gestational age (may be term or preterm) . LBW infants may be born at term. In addition, some LBW babies may be categorised as: Very LBW: birth weight of less than 1500 grams . Extremely LBW: birth weight of less than 1000 grams Module 1 Unit 1.1 Session 1.1.2. When women are identified as being at risk of having a small-for-gestational-age fetus or newborn, provide advice about modifiable risk factors. Refer women with a major risk factor or multiple other factors associated with having a small-for-gestational-age fetus/newborn for ultrasound assessment of fetal size and wellbeing at 28–30 and 34–36 weeks gestation.

Small for gestational age birth is preceded in many cases by intrauterine growth retardation (IUGR), which is defined by prenatal determination of delayed . in utero . growth. The timeframe for ultrasound assessment of gestational age overlaps with that for assessment of nuchal translucency thickness as part of testing for fetal chromosomal anomalies (11 weeks to 13 weeks 6 days), which may enable some women to have both tests in a single scan. Document the infant’s gestational age in weeks. (Mother/caregiver can self-report, or referral information from the medical provider may be used.) Subtract the child’s gestational age in weeks from 40 weeks (gestational age of term infant) to determine the adjustment for prematurity in weeks.
